FEDERAL TRADE COMMISSION
[Docket C-3378]


Mannesmann, A.G.; Prohibited Trade Practices and Affirmative 
Corrective Actions

AGENCY: Federal Trade Commission.

ACTION: Set aside order.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: This order reopens a 1992 consent order--which required 
Mannesmann to divest the Buschman Co. and to obtain, for 10 years, 
Commission approval prior to acquiring any business that manufactures 
and sells certain conveyor systems--and sets aside the consent order 
pursuant to the Commission's Prior Approval Policy Statement. The order 
cites the availability of the premerger notification and waiting period 
requirements, and noted that under the Policy Statement, the Commission 
presumes that the public interest requires setting aside the prior 
approval requirement in Paragraph V of the order.

DATES: Consent Order issued March 24, 1992. Set aside order issued 
October 11, 1995.\1\
